    Institutional Dimension of Burnout in Governmental Psychosocial and Community Programmes: Gaps between Intervening Conditions, Consequences, and Guidelines for Improvement
    (2024) Daher, Marianne; Rosati, Antonia; Tomicic, Alemka; Hernandez, Angie; Alfaro, Jaime
    This article analyses burnout in governmental psychosocial and community programmes considering training/knowledge, the technical-professional field, the institutional framework, and networking, based on the experience of the intervention teams of three Chilean programmes. A qualitative methodology was used. Fifty people, most of them psychologists, participated in interviews and focus groups. The data were analysed according to Grounded Theory. Results indicate that burnout is a corrosive process in governmental psychosocial and community programmes. The causes of burnout are related to three gaps: between academic training and professional performance, between formulation and implementation, and between the obligation to work as part of a network and the limitations of this approach. Furthermore, we observed manifestations consequences and effects of burnout, and guidelines for improving the programmes. We discuss the institutional dimension of burnout in governmental psychosocial and community programmes and reflect on aspects that may improve team well-being and the quality of social policies.

    The Intersectoral Cascade: a Case Study on Perceived Conflict in Implementing Child Development Systems
    (2023) Quiroz-Saavedra, Rodrigo; Alfaro, Jaime; Rodriguez-Rivas, Matias E.; Lastra, Valentina
    This article presents a case study on perceived conflict and its outcomes on implementing a system of programs and services for child development support. A multi-level collaboration model is used to deeply examine aspects of conflicts perceived by professionals responsible for implementing the system at the national, state, and local levels. This research adopted a single case approach with qualitative methods using semi-structured interviews and exploratory thematic analysis. A total of 29 professionals working at social development and health ministries, state departments, and one municipality participated in this study. The results show that professionals perceive one main unresolved conflict at each of the ecological levels. These conflicts are related to an informalized collaboration agreement between the Ministry of Social Development and the Ministry of Education, an interrupted resource flow from the national level to local level, and an unmanageable internal pressure at the state level. Furthermore, the compensatory strategies they use to deal with these conflicts are ineffective and lead to negative implementation outcomes. We suggest that future research should explore systemic conflict for the collaboration processes among the professionals to improve, thus increasing the quality of system implementation.
